MoonPay vs Binance Comparison
MoonPay and Binance serve very different purposes in the crypto ecosystem. MoonPay is a fiat-to-crypto on-ramp designed for quick, easy purchases with credit cards or bank transfers. Binance is the world's largest cryptocurrency exchange by trading volume, offering advanced trading features and hundreds of cryptocurrencies.
Fee Comparison
MoonPay charges:
- 4.5% for credit/debit cards, Apple Pay, Google Pay, and PayPal
- 1% for bank transfers
- 0% for MoonPay Balance
- Additional spread built into pricing
Binance charges:
- 0.1% standard trading fee (maker/taker)
- 0.075% with BNB discount
- 2% for credit/debit card purchases
- Free P2P trading
Who Should Use Each?
Choose MoonPay if: You want the simplest possible way to buy crypto with a card, need to purchase quickly without creating an exchange account, or live in a region where Binance isn't available.
Choose Binance if: You want the lowest possible fees, plan to trade actively, need access to hundreds of altcoins, or want advanced features like futures and margin trading.
Key Takeaways
For most users, Binance offers significantly better value due to its low fees. However, MoonPay's simplicity makes it useful for one-time purchases or for users who find exchanges intimidating. If you're in the US, note that you'll need to use Binance.US, which has a more limited feature set than the global platform.
